The defining feature of the Neurosurgery Heaney Tissue Forceps, 7½″ 1×2 Teeth is the precision-machined 1×2 teeth configuration. The interlocking teeth provide a secure grip on delicate tissues while reducing tissue slippage and minimizing unnecessary compression. This design allows surgeons to manipulate fascia, connective tissue, membranes, blood vessels, and other soft tissue structures with exceptional confidence while preserving tissue integrity. The carefully engineered tooth pattern distributes gripping pressure evenly, supporting atraumatic tissue handling throughout delicate neurological procedures.

Product Specifications
| Specification | Details |
|---|---|
| Product Name | Neurosurgery Heaney Tissue Forceps |
| Overall Length | 7½″ (Approximately 19 cm) |
| Teeth Configuration | 1×2 Teeth |
| Pattern | Heaney |
| Tip Type | Tissue Grasping Tips |
| Handle Type | Spring Handle |
| Material | Premium Medical-Grade Stainless Steel |
| Finish | Satin Surgical Finish |
| Instrument Type | Tissue Forceps |
| Specialty | Neurosurgery |
| Applications | Tissue Grasping, Cranial Surgery, Spinal Surgery, Microsurgery |
| Reusable | Yes |
| Sterilization | Steam Autoclave Compatible |
| Corrosion Resistant | Yes |
| Latex-Free | Yes |
| Quality Standard | International Surgical Instrument Standards |
